Transaction 51a12d2cc31e4f76d2df005f085513dcb141265ced5df158ac47e85b6d893e6a

1 Input
2 Outputs
  • 51a12d2cc31e4f76d2df005f085513dcb141265ced5df158ac47e85b6d893e6a:0
  • value  347040
    address  32MHpnJ34Z59Eo6Ne4FpfVeiopK9WySeZW
  • 51a12d2cc31e4f76d2df005f085513dcb141265ced5df158ac47e85b6d893e6a:1
  • value  66846632
    address  1EQExo9WYR24iUvo2m1s9EFXYG8UdHtySB